Solution:

Consider the following system of linear equations:

Equation 1:


6x+7y=17

Equation 2:


x=22-5y

Replacing the above equation into equation 1, we get:


6(22-5y)+7y=17

Applying the distributive property, we get:


132-30y+7y=17

this is equivalent to:


-30y+7y=17-132

this is equivalent to:


-23y=\text{ -115}

or


23y=\text{ 115}

solving for y, we obtain:


y=(115)/(23)=5

Now, replacing this into Equation 2, we obtain:


x=22-5(5)=22-25=-3

So that, we can conclude that the correct answer is:

The solution is (-3, 5)
